Sweet Pepper Pizzas

Start with an easy roasted red pepper sauce, spread on the crust, then top with broccoli and goat cheese for a red and green pizza that's healthy and delicious.

Servings:
4 mini pizzas
Ingredients

Directions
1.
Combine roasted red peppers, garlic, honey, salt and pepper in a blender or food processor until smooth.
2.
Spread the sauce and toppings on 4 mini pizza crusts (see Basic Pizza Dough recipe on www.parents.com); bake for 8 minutes at 425 degrees F.
